What reaction produces the suns energy?

The Sun produces energy through nuclear fusion in its core. This process involves the fusion of hydrogen atoms into helium atoms, releasing a large amount of energy in the form of light and heat.

What nuclear reaction combines gas to form helium and produce most of the suns energy?

The nuclear reaction that combines hydrogen to form helium and produces most of the sun's energy is called nuclear fusion. In this reaction, hydrogen nuclei (protons) fuse together to form helium nuclei, releasing a large amount of energy in the form of light and heat.
